This invention relates to a gauge which is designed to indicate'the variations of the level of a liquid and more particularly. to a gauge of this character which may be used on the radiator of an automobile for jthe purpose of indicating the height of the Water therein 'and thusenable the attendant to replenishthe radiator with water from timeto time, as required, for maintaining the same in thehighest state of efiiciency and also avoid injury to the parts'associated with the radiator.
:It is the object of this invention to proconstruction', which can be readily applied to the. standard typesv of radiators now on theemarket and which will give a reliable indication when the water in the radiator s below normal. j i a In the accompanying drawings: Figure 1 is. a vertical sectional elevation of'an auto mobile radiator equipped with my improved liquid gauge. Figures 2 and 3 are horizontal sections taken on the correspondingly numbered lines inFig. 1;
Similar characters of reference refer to like parts throughout the several views.
My invention is useful for indicating the variations in the level of a liquid which may be contained in receptacles of various kinds, but more particularly the water level within the upper tank or box 10 of an automobile radiator, which latter is provided in its top with an upright filling nipple or collar 11 through which the water is introduced from time to time to replenish waste due to leakage and evaporation. Ordinarily this fill ing collar 11 is closed by means of an ordi nary screw cap, which is detachably connected with the collar by nieansof a screw joint and provided in its top 13 with a central opening 14.
My improved liquid gauge is mounted on this cap or cover and in its preferred form the same is constructed as follows Projecting downwardly through'the opening 14.- in the top of the filler cap is a tubular nipple or body 15 which in its preferred 1922. Serial No. ssaoe form has its lower end provided with an internal flange 17, the central part of which is provided with a perforation 18. Above the filler cap is arranged a hood, dome or casing 19 of hollow form which in the preferred construction is of larger diameter than the nipple and has its lower end connected with the upper end of thesame by a horizontal web 20 which forms a downwardly facing shoulder 16 on the underside of the web engaging the upper side of the top 13,said
nipple, dome and web being preferably 1 formed in one piece by castingor otherwise. On the upper part "of the front and rear sides of this hood the same is provided with sight openings 21, 21, which permit-ofIobserving the interior of this hood fromv the front and rear sides thereof.
Sliding vertically in the opening 18 and guided by the latter is'an upright shifting rod 22, the upper part of which terminates within the hood and isprovided in the latter with an indicator head23 which in the preferred form has the shape of a sphere, as shown in Figs. land 2, and is connected with the shifting rod by means of a screw joints To the lower end ofthisshifting rod 1 i is secured a float 24 which is adapted to ride on the liquid within the tank or receptacle 10 and rise and fall therewith in response to variations in the level 'of the liquid within'the tank." This float maybe of anyysuitable construction, but as shown in the drawings, the same is preferably made in the form of a hollow sheet metal body and secured by means of a screw end of the shifting rod.
The nipple 15 is secured in place on the filler capby means ofa clamping screw nut 25 engagingwith an external screw thread on the lower end of this nipple and bearing against the underside of the cap top 13 through the medium of an interposed washer 26, thereby holding the nipple 15 and hood 19 in place on the filler cap and also forming a leak-tight joint between the same. one side, the clamping nut 25 is provided a with a downwardly projecting guide arm 27 which latter is provided at its lower end joint to the lower with a guide eye 28 which receives the lower part of the shifting rod 22 above the float vertical movements and maintain the float and indicator head in their proper positions.
When the level of the liquid in the tank or p will be either wholly or partly concealed from View through the sight opening and thuswarn the attendant that the water supin the, tank requiresreplenishing. It will therefore be evident that by these means the attendant can always keep av careful watch on thesupply of waterin the radiator without "necessitating the removal or ,the filler capffor this purpose and thus ensure maintaining the 'radiator in its highest state of efiiciency and preventing injury to. any
I the parts associated 'therewith iwhi'ch would be liable'to occur if the water level ,b ec oi rie slunduly 19w or exhausted.,
a y mounting this liqui' dTgau'ge on th e radiato r fille r cap the. same is renioved f om .pearan'ce. a
the radiatortank with the cap, and, restored thereto as a unit, thereby avoiding the use of any extra parts whichlare liable to become misplacedand also avoiding the n ecessity of alteringthe tank or operative parts tliepraldi'atorfor thep'urpose of applying this11iquid. gauge thereto.
